不同网络环境下 全量加速器对手机视频体验有何影响?
全量
全量加速器的要点是兼容各平台与配置。 在当下移动端网络环境日趋复杂的背景下,作为产品或开发者,你需要清晰界定“全量加速器”的核心目标:提升不同型号、不同系统版本的网络请求效率,同时确保应用行为的一致性与稳定性。本文将从体验、技术实现、合规与信任四个维度,梳理在安卓与 iPhone 上部署全量加速器的关键要点,帮助你快速落地并获得可观的性能提升。你需要关注的,是跨设备的通用性、低延迟的优化路径,以及在不同网络条件下的自适应策略。
要点一聚焦兼容性。你将面临多种 CPU 架构、内存容量、网络能力与系统安全策略的差异。为实现真正的全量覆盖,建议以“最低兼容列表+渐进式特性检测”为设计原则:先定义必须支持的核心功能,然后在设备上线前通过自检机制确认剩余特性是否可用,并在应用启动阶段根据检测结果动态启用或降级。通过这种策略,你的全量加速器能在多数设备上稳定运行,同时对边缘设备保持良好的可扩展性。
要点二是性能与资源平衡。你需要对网络端和设备端的开销进行精确评估,确保加速器不会引入显著的 CPU、内存或电量消耗。实际操作中,可以采用分层缓存、按网络类型自适应切换、以及对代理路径的最小化修改等做法,以实现“提升体验的同时不牺牲电量效率”。在安卓和 iPhone 两端,合理的策略是以轻量级探针 + 动态阈值为核心的自适应方案,避免在高负载场景下产生反效果。
要点三是安全与合规。尤其对安卓平台,需遵循分区权限、网络安全配置以及应用沙箱的约束;对 iPhone,要兼顾系统安全通道、VPN 架构及 App Transport Security 的要求。为提升信任度,建议在官方文档和公开数据基础上,配合严格的权限最小化、数据最小化与透明的日志策略。若你希望查阅权威资料,可以参考 Android Developers 与 Apple Developer 的安全最佳实践,以及国际标准组织对网络代理与隐私保护的规定,以确保你的实现具备长期的可维持性与合规性。
要点四是测试与监控。实现全量加速后,务必建立跨设备的对比测试用例,覆盖高、低带宽、丢包、漫游与离线场景。监控指标应聚焦端到端时延、请求重传率、CPU/内存占用、以及用户感知的体感加速效果。通过持续集成和阶段性回滚机制,可以在实际上线后快速定位问题并逐步优化。下面的要点清单可帮助你高效执行:
在实践中,你还可以参考权威资源了解最新趋势与最佳实践。Android Developers 的网络与性能优化文档提供了多维度的性能诊断方法与实现建议,官网链接为 https://developer.android.com。Apple Developer 的网络与安全指南则帮助你理解 iOS 生态中对代理与加速解决方案的要求,访问地址为 https://developer.apple.com。若你关注全球隐私与数据保护的动态,World Wide Web Consortium(W3C)的安全与隐私工作组也提供了重要规范与解读,相关信息可浏览 https://www.w3.org。通过结合官方资料、行业研究与实际测试,你的全量加速器才能获得持续的信任与竞争力。
全量加速器需跨平台适配与系统级优化,你在设计时要考虑不同硬件架构、处理器型号与功耗管理的差异,确保同一套算法在Android与iPhone上都能稳定运行。为了提升真实世界的表现,你需要将资源负载、缓存策略、以及异步任务调度等关键点,与系统调度机制深度绑定。了解各平台的能力边界,能帮助你降低兼容成本并提升用户体验。参考资料方面,Android开发者文档中关于性能优化的章节,以及苹果的高效能应用指南,都是不错的起点。进一步参考Android网络与硬件协同的实践经验,可以提升判定与处理的精准性。
在硬件层面,你要评估不同CPU架构、内存带宽、图形处理单元及传感器集成的差异。对于安卓设备,制造商自带的优化套件和OEM定制化的系统补丁可能影响你应用对全量加速器的认知,因此需要做广泛的兼容性测试。你可以通过官方的性能测试工具,如Android Benchmark、Profile GPU、以及在高/低端设备上的回归测试,来定位瓶颈。对于苹果设备,需关注A系列与M系列芯片在机器学习和异步调度方面的差异,并遵循Apple Developer Documentation中的最佳实践来实现一致性体验。
在软件层面,核心原则是把算法与资源管理分离:将计算密集型任务放在后台队列,使用高效的并发模型,并结合系统节能策略进行自适应。你可以建立跨平台的抽象层,确保顶层接口在Android与iOS上行为一致,同时通过条件编译与运行时分支实现不同实现的无缝切换。参考Android的WorkManager与iOS的后台任务框架的设计模式,能帮助你在不同系统中实现稳定的调度。关于网络与数据缓存,优先选用统一的序列化格式与增量更新策略,以减少跨平台的数据不一致。
具体实施清单如下,供你在开发阶段逐步核对:
如需深入了解跨平台优化的具体规范,可参考 Android 官方性能优化文档与 Apple 的高效能应用指南,并结合实测数据不断迭代。实际操作中,你应把“全量加速器”作为贯穿整个应用生命周期的性能目标,确保在不同手机型号间仍然保持一致的体验与响应速度。若对对齐不同平台的标准有疑问,欢迎对照权威文献进行对比分析,并在社区中分享复现步骤与测试结果,以提升整体可信度与实用性。
全量加速器要实现跨平台兼容与高效加速,本段将从实操角度帮助你在安卓与iPhone上部署时,选择最优协议、确保加密强度,并通过合理的网络优化提升全局体验。你需要理解,不同手机型号对网络栈的实现差异会影响代理接入、握手延迟与带宽利用,因此在设计时务必以兼容性为先,以实际测试结果为依据进行迭代。
在我的实战经验中,先明确目标是覆盖主流系统版本与机型,例如安卓端尽量兼容至Android 10及以上,iPhone端覆盖iOS 13及更高版本。接着,结合公开权威指南选择底层传输协议与加密方案。别忽视对网络环境的适配:运营商网络切换、Wi‑Fi与蜂窝网络的切换、以及国际互联的延迟波动都会直接影响体验。权威来源指出,TLS1.3在握手速度和安全性方面具有明显优势,美国互联网安全与加密标准制定机构(IETF)的最新规范也持续推荐尽量使用最新版本的TLS与加密算法。你可以参考苹果官方的网络隐私与安全文档,以及Android开发者的网络安全最佳实践来对齐实现。
在实现层面,我常采用分阶段验证的方法,确保每一步都可回滚、易于诊断。你在测试阶段应覆盖如下要点:协议选择的兼容性、加密套件的强度与性能开销、以及网络优化策略对不同设备的实际收益。同时,注意在不同区域的网络环境下对比数据,以避免局部实验结果误导整体部署。为了帮助你更好地对齐行业标准,可以关注权威机构的公开研究与报告,例如关于VPN与代理在移动网络中的性能评估,以及最新的RFC文档对协议栈的规定。 你也可以查看诸如https://www.ietf.org/、https://developer.apple.com/、https://developer.android.com/ 等权威资源获取最新信息。
为确保方案的可落地性,下面给出可执行的步骤清单,帮助你快速落地并保持迭代能力:
在总结阶段,确保你的部署方案具备可验证的证据链:对照官方文档与独立测试数据,公开的对比结果能显著提升用户信任度。若需要进一步参考的外部资源,建议定期阅读IETF、Apple Developer、Android Developers等权威机构的公开文档与更新,确保全量加速器在多平台上的表现始终符合行业标准。你可以通过以下链接获取更多权威信息:IETF、Apple 网络框架文档、Android 开发者。
跨平台兼容性是部署成败的关键,在你部署全量加速器时,需关注不同系统对网络、权限与资源调度的差异。你要以实际场景为导向,通过对系统层面的约束、应用沙箱机制、以及系统更新节奏的综合评估,来制定一套稳健的兼容策略。为确保理解清晰,请参考 Android 官方文档对网络权限的规定(https://developer.android.com/guide/topics/permissions/overview)以及 Apple 对沙箱与权限的最新说明(https://developer.apple.com/documentation/security/app_sandboxing)。
在安卓端,你可能遇到的挑战包括不同厂商自定义的网络栈和权限模型差异、后台限制、以及应用生命周期对全量加速器行为的影响。为了避免因厂商定制导致的行为偏差,建议你以标准 AOSP 行为为基准,同时通过分布式测试覆盖最常见的系统版本与安全策略组合。你可以查阅 Android 的后台工作原理与限制说明,帮助你设计更鲁棒的网络调度与资源回收策略(https://developer.android.com/guide/components/activities/backgrounding)。
在 iOS 端,系统强制的隐私与网络安全策略会对全量加速器的执行路径产生显著影响。你需要确保请求的权限清单、网络代理/优化模块的实现,均符合 iOS 的沙箱边界与 App Transport Security 要求。官方文档提供了对网络请求、权限以及后台任务的明确指引,参考资料包括苹果开发者中心的最新网络安全章节(https://developer.apple.com/documentation/security)。
以下是诊断与解决的要点要素,供你在实际部署时快速执行:
持续监控与迭代,是确保全量加速器在多机型上稳定运行的核心。 部署完成后,你需要建立一个覆盖监控、诊断、优化的闭环体系。你将通过客观数据来评估在不同系统版本、不同分辨率、不同网络条件下的表现,确保设备差异不成为用户体验的瓶颈。参考权威资料,你可以结合 Android Performance(https://developer.android.com/topic/performance)与 Apple Metrics(https://developer.apple.com/documentation/os_attribution)的最新做法,来设计监控指标体系。
在实际执行中,先明确关键指标(如启动耗时、页面渲染时间、网络请求时延、内存占用、崩溃率等),并将其映射到全量加速器的工作流程。你可以建立一个分阶段的监控计划,确保不同机型的覆盖率和数据可比性。使用可视化仪表盘,你将快速识别异常波动,避免盲目优化导致的副作用。可参考 https://web.dev/performance-monitoring/ 的监控要点与案例。
其次,进行数据驱动的优化循坏。你需要收集以下信息后再行动:设备型号分布、运营商差异、应用版本差异、网络环境等级,以及用户活跃时段。基于这些维度,按优先级排定优化任务,确保“高回报低风险”优先执行。执行过程中,保留可回滚的变更点,并记录每次迭代的结果,以便在新机型出现时快速重复验证。
为确保长期兼容性,建议建立与第三方流量分析和性能测试工具的对接,例如结合 Google Lighthouse、Studio 诊断报告、以及原生日志分析系统。这样,你可以在新机型发布前后,快速复现潜在问题并预演解决方案。更多权威参考与工具信息,请参阅相关文档与指南:Android Performance、Apple Developer、Web.dev 的性能监控篇章,以及专业分析平台的对接方案。
核心目标是提升跨设备的网络请求效率,同时兼容不同型号与系统版本,并确保应用行为的一致性与稳定性。
采用最低兼容列表+渐进式特性检测的设计原则,在设备上线前进行自检并在应用启动阶段根据检测结果动态开启或降级相关功能,以实现稳定覆盖与可扩展性。
需要对网络端和设备端开销进行评估,使用分层缓存、按网络类型自适应切换以及最小化代理路径的修改来平衡体验与电量消耗。